Our Client is seeking a motivated Electrical Substation Design Engineer to join their team and support the planning, design, and delivery of high‑quality substation projects. This role is ideal for individuals who enjoy collaborative engineering environments, are passionate about safety, and are looking to grow their technical expertise in power systems design.
Key Responsibilities
- Promote and model safe work practices in alignment with corporate safety standards.
- Support the department’s goal of eliminating workplace injuries and preventable driving incidents.
- Collaborate with cross‑functional engineering teams to drive efficiency, innovation, and continuous improvement.
- Coordinate technical project information— including studies, calculations, sketches, and design data— to support the engineering and construction of electrical substation facilities.
- Partner with multiple engineering disciplines to assess existing infrastructure and develop conceptual design solutions.
- Develop detailed electrical substation design drawings using 3D design tools, covering both indoor and outdoor equipment such as relays, meters, annunciators, breakers, transformers, batteries, and switchgear.
- Produce technical documentation including single-line diagrams, schematics, control room layouts, grounding plans, conduit designs, and general arrangement drawings.
- Prepare bills of materials, conduit/circuit schedules, technical reports, and project presentations using standard office applications.
- Participate in and lead design review meetings with internal stakeholders.
- Deliver accurate, high‑quality design packages on schedule and within budget.
- Travel up to 10% as required.
